WebPhysical Description. Green frogs are typically yellow, green, olive or brown, with some dark spots on the back and a bright green upper lip. Their belly is white with dark lines or spots, and it sometimes has a yellow tinge. The hind legs have dark lines and webbed toes, while the front feet are unwebbed. Although rare, it is possible to see ... WebCommon names: American green frog, Green frog. The northern green frog is native to the eastern United States. The frog has been introduced to Washington in a few places. NatureServe identifies the status of the northern green frog as an “exotic” (non-native) in Washington. Documented occurrences are in Whatcom, Stevens and King counties.

WebThe northern green frog is the only native green frog subspecies found in New Hampshire. The green frogs' calls sound similar to a loose banjo string. They are usually heard as single, rhythmic notes. Green frogs will emit an alarm call when startled that sounds similar to a yelp.
